About Sedex
Sedex is a trusted partner for over 95,000 businesses worldwide, helping them create socially and environmentally sustainable supply chains. Through our platform's powerful data insights and expert guidance, we simplify the management, assessment, and reporting of sustainability performance.
Our Vision is to be a leader in making global supply chains more socially and environmentally sustainable. Our Mission is to provide data-driven insights, accessible tools, and exceptional services that support businesses in improving environmental, social, and governance (ESG) performance and outcomes.
The Role
We are looking for a Strategic Partnerships Delivery Manager to drive the execution and delivery of Sedex's global partner ecosystem. This role focuses on onboarding, enabling, and managing partners that bring measurable value. You will work hands-on to identify new opportunities, bring partners and ensure they are supported to deliver results for our customers and business.
Key Responsibilities
- Partner Growth & Acquisition: Identify and onboard new partners that add tangible value to Sedex's offerings and customers. Expand the partner network across priority sectors and regions, including audit firms, resellers, and tech providers. Work closely with sales and regional teams to support go-to-market execution and partner-led opportunities.
- Partner Onboarding & Enablement: Deliver effective onboarding processes to get partners up and running quickly and successfully. Provide tools, training, and support materials that help partners position and deliver Sedex solutions. Drive day-to-day partner support and issue resolution to keep delivery on track.
- Performance Management: Monitor partner activity, performance, and contribution to pipeline and revenue. Use data and feedback to identify high-performing partners and areas for improvement. Support the execution of partner incentive programs and growth plans.
- Collaboration & Relationship Management: Build strong working relationships with partner contacts, acting as a reliable point of coordination and delivery. Work with internal teams (sales, product, marketing) to ensure partners are aligned with current goals and offerings. Represent Sedex in industry or partner meetings, as needed.
Knowledge, Skills & Experience
- 5+ years of hands-on experience in partnerships, account management, or business development—ideally in technology, software, or related services.
- Demonstrated success in onboarding and managing partners that drive revenue or customer value.
- Strong project coordination and execution skills.
- Able to build trusted relationships and work collaboratively across teams.
- Commercial mindset with a focus on delivering outcomes.
- Experience in ESG or sustainability is a plus, but not required.
